Author Information

Seamond Ponsart Roberts spent her childhood in the 1940s and '50s at the Massachusetts lighthouses on Cuttyhunk Island and at West Chop on Martha's Vineyard, where her father was the keeper. She lives now with her husband, David, in Pineville, Louisiana. Jeremy D'Entremont is the author of more than ten books on lighthouses and maritime history. He lives in Portsmouth, New Hampshire.
